{ "AssemblyIdentity": "Microsoft.AspNetCore.TestHost, Version=1.0.0.0, Culture=neutral, PublicKeyToken=adb9793829ddae60", "Types": [ { "Name": "Microsoft.AspNetCore.TestHost.ClientHandler", "Visibility": "Public", "Kind": "Class", "BaseType": "System.Net.Http.HttpMessageHandler", "ImplementedInterfaces": [], "Members": [ { "Kind": "Method", "Name": "SendAsync", "Parameters": [ { "Name": "request", "Type": "System.Net.Http.HttpRequestMessage" }, { "Name": "cancellationToken", "Type": "System.Threading.CancellationToken" } ], "ReturnType": "System.Threading.Tasks.Task", "Virtual": true, "Override": true, "Visibility": "Protected", "GenericParameter": [] }, { "Kind": "Constructor", "Name": ".ctor", "Parameters": [ { "Name": "pathBase", "Type": "Microsoft.AspNetCore.Http.PathString" }, { "Name": "application", "Type": "Microsoft.AspNetCore.Hosting.Server.IHttpApplication" } ], "Visibility": "Public", "GenericParameter": [] } ], "GenericParameters": [] }, { "Name": "Microsoft.AspNetCore.TestHost.RequestBuilder", "Visibility": "Public", "Kind": "Class", "ImplementedInterfaces": [], "Members": [ { "Kind": "Method", "Name": "And", "Parameters": [ { "Name": "configure", "Type": "System.Action" } ], "ReturnType": "Microsoft.AspNetCore.TestHost.RequestBuilder",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"AddHeader", "Parameters": [ { "Name": "name", "Type": "System.String" }, { "Name": "value", "Type": "System.String" } ], "ReturnType": "Microsoft.AspNetCore.TestHost.RequestBuilder",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"SendAsync", "Parameters": [ { "Name": "method", "Type": "System.String" } ], "ReturnType": "System.Threading.Tasks.Task",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"GetAsync", "Parameters": [], "ReturnType": "System.Threading.Tasks.Task",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"PostAsync", "Parameters": [], "ReturnType": "System.Threading.Tasks.Task",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Constructor", "Name": ".ctor", "Parameters": [ { "Name": "server", "Type": "Microsoft.AspNetCore.TestHost.TestServer" }, { "Name": "path", "Type": "System.String" } ], "Visibility": "Public", "GenericParameter": [] } ], "GenericParameters": [] }, { "Name": "Microsoft.AspNetCore.TestHost.TestServer", "Visibility": "Public", "Kind": "Class", "ImplementedInterfaces": [ "Microsoft.AspNetCore.Hosting.Server.IServer" ], "Members": [ { "Kind": "Method", "Name": "get_BaseAddress", "Parameters": [], "ReturnType": "System.Uri",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"set_BaseAddress", "Parameters": [ { "Name": "value", "Type": "System.Uri" } ], "ReturnType": "System.Void",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"get_Host", "Parameters": [], "ReturnType": "Microsoft.AspNetCore.Hosting.IWebHost",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"CreateHandler", "Parameters": [], "ReturnType": "System.Net.Http.HttpMessageHandler",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"CreateClient", "Parameters": [], "ReturnType": "System.Net.Http.HttpClient",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"CreateWebSocketClient", "Parameters": [], "ReturnType": "Microsoft.AspNetCore.TestHost.WebSocketClient",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"CreateRequest", "Parameters": [ { "Name": "path", "Type": "System.String" } ], "ReturnType": "Microsoft.AspNetCore.TestHost.RequestBuilder",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"Dispose", "Parameters": [], "ReturnType": "System.Void", "Sealed": true, "Virtual": true, "ImplementedInterface": "System.IDisposable",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Constructor", "Name": ".ctor", "Parameters": [ { "Name": "builder", "Type": "Microsoft.AspNetCore.Hosting.IWebHostBuilder" } ], "Visibility": "Public", "GenericParameter": [] } ], "GenericParameters": [] }, { "Name": "Microsoft.AspNetCore.TestHost.WebSocketClient", "Visibility": "Public", "Kind": "Class", "ImplementedInterfaces": [], "Members": [ { "Kind": "Method", "Name": "get_SubProtocols", "Parameters": [], "ReturnType": "System.Collections.Generic.IList",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"get_ConfigureRequest", "Parameters": [], "ReturnType": "System.Action",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"set_ConfigureRequest", "Parameters": [ { "Name": "value", "Type": "System.Action" } ], "ReturnType": "System.Void", "Visibility": "Public", "GenericParameter": [] }, { "Kind": "Method", "Name": "ConnectAsync", "Parameters": [ { "Name": "uri", "Type": "System.Uri" }, { "Name": "cancellationToken", "Type": "System.Threading.CancellationToken" } ], "ReturnType": "System.Threading.Tasks.Task", "Visibility": "Public", "GenericParameter": [] } ], "GenericParameters": [] } ] }